What the High Beam Indicator Means on a Jaguar XJ

The blue high-beam indicator on a Jaguar XJ confirms your main (full) beam headlights are on. It is purely informational, reminding you to dip them for oncoming traffic.

Professional Mechanic Tips

Field notes from Marcus Vale, ASE-Certified Master Technician
Auto high beam relies on a clean windscreen camera; road grime or a sticker in front of it causes odd behaviour.
If the blue light is on in town traffic on a Jaguar XJ, you have full beam engaged — dip it to avoid dazzling everyone ahead.
